For those who don't already know, I contributed some chapters to this volume, so take this as my conflict of interest disclosure. Having said that, it was clear to me from the beginning that this book was going to be subject to a VERY wide range of opinion due to its broad objectives. This book is an attempt to get all the main elements of our technical body of knowledge between two covers. Not in a comprehensive, all-encompassing way, but in a way that lays out the boundaries of the current state of the art.https://www.zulfugar.nl/wp-content/plugins/formcraft/file-upload/server/content/files/162887b0443b70---canada-foreign-worker-manual.pdf And to do so in a way that created some context for how we might think about these component pieces and perhaps lay the foundation for future growth. And to provide a common framework for both students and teachers to create courses and assess learning. And, finally, to provide financial planning practice owners with a way to set appropriate expectations for their new and experienced staff. This is not a personal finance book. If you're looking for another Financial Planning for Dummies book, this isn't it. This very large book has very modest aspirations; it's an attempt to put a few stakes in the ground with respect to what we know and what we still need to figure out. It's meant to foster further dialogue, not be the final answer. Enjoy.
